Rosette Nebula (Caldwell 49)

The Rosette Nebula (Caldwell 49), a large emission nebula in the constellation Monoceros, lies about 5,000 light-years from Earth. At its center is a young cluster of hot stars whose radiation has carved out the dark central cavity and illuminates the surrounding hydrogen gas, creating the nebula’s distinctive rose-like structure.
